June 20 tribunal could determine the fate of Mercedes F1 future

June 20 tribunal could determine the fate of Mercedes F1 future 8 June, 2013 Lewis Hamilton during FP1 in Canada There is a growing consensus in the paddock that Mercedes will be penalised when the FIA's brand-new international tribunal meets to discuss the secret Barcelona test on June 20, which in turn may cause the Stuttgart manufacturer to reassess their Formula 1 involvement. Sauber team boss Monisha Kaltenborn, who entered Formula 1 as a team lawyer, told Auto Motor und Sport: 'A contract can't overrule a law.'
